This business doesn't know how to manage its website or its inventory. I ordered an item on their website that took hours to order due to their website constantly crashing and making extra steps for customers to complete before even adding the item to the cart. Then, when trying to check out, the item would disappear from the cart. After I finally successfully purchased the item, the company wanted me to "confirm" my order by reaching out the them (as if I hadn't done that on their website already). I call and speak to an associate who confirms the order only to get an email the next day stating that the item was out of stock and that my order was cancelled. How did the associate not know this at the time of my "confirmation" call. As a result, this company charged me for an item they never really had in stock. This is the worst shopping experience I've ever had. As a business, if you can't handle selling a limited-edition item, don't try to. This business's attempt to due so was a failure and upset many loyal customers of that brand. They have no respect for their customers, as is evident in the solution they offered me: a coupon (as if I'll ever shop there again).
